Resolution will be based on official ATP results.Carlos Alcaraz withdrew from the Barcelona Open Banc Sabadell ahead of his round-of-16 clash with Tomas Machac due to a right wrist and forearm injury sustained during his first-round win over qualifier Otto Virtanen on April 14. The world No. 2 called for a medical timeout at 4-4 in the opening set amid sharp pain, skipped practice sessions, and confirmed the pullout on April 15, ending his title defense early on home clay where he holds a dominant record. Machac, ranked No. 47, advanced past Sebastian Baez in straight sets and enters with head-to-head parity at 1-1—their most recent encounter a Shanghai quarterfinal win for the Czech on hard courts last October. Traders note Alcaraz's clay prowess and rest advantages were overshadowed by the confirmed withdrawal, handing Machac a walkover amid looming French Open preparations.
